當前位置:首頁 » 文件管理 » 文件夾所有文件名

文件夾所有文件名

發布時間: 2025-06-26 04:21:14

❶ 如何從文件夾中提取所有文件名

從文件夾中提取所有文件名的方法如下

方法一:手動復制粘貼(適用於少量文件)

  • 步驟:將文件夾中的文件逐一重命名(如果尚未命名),然後在可編輯狀態下復制文件名,粘貼到目標文檔(如Word、Excel等)中。
  • 優點:操作簡單,無需特殊工具或命令。
  • 缺點:效率低下,尤其對於大量文件時;完成後需手動核對,以防遺漏或錯誤。

方法二:利用DOS命令與Excel(適用於大量文件)

  • 步驟一:在DOS或Windows命令提示符下,使用DIR命令將指定文件夾下的所有文件及文件夾名輸出到文本文件。例如,要提取C盤Windows目錄下的所有文件及文件夾名,可輸入命令C:windowsdir > d:1.txt後回車。
  • 步驟二:打開一個新的Excel電子表格,使用「數據」菜單下的「導入外部數據」功能,選擇「導入數據」命令,找到並打開上一步生成的文本文件(如D盤下的1.txt)。
  • 步驟三:在「文本導入向導」中,按照提示設置數據分隔符(如分號、逗號、空格等,以及DIR命令特有的「.」作為文件名與擴展名的分隔符),並完成數據導入。
  • 步驟四:在導入的數據中,第一列通常包含文件名(可能因DIR命令顯示限制而只顯示部分漢字),但第七列(G列)通常包含完整的文件名。第八列則是文件名的後綴,便於篩選。
  • 優點:高效快捷,尤其適用於大量文件;數據導入Excel後便於管理和查詢。
  • 缺點:需要一定的計算機操作基礎;對於不熟悉DOS命令和Excel導入功能的用戶來說,可能有一定的學習成本。

綜上所述,對於大量文件的提取和管理,推薦使用方法二,即利用DOS命令與Excel的導入功能來實現。

❷ 怎樣列印出文件夾下所有的文件名

要列印出文件夾下所有的文件名,可以使用不同的方法,具體取決於你使用的操作系統和可用的工具。以下是一些常見的方法:

1. **Windows命令行(CMD)**:
打開命令提示符(CMD),使用`cd`命令切換到目標文件夾,然後輸入以下命令:
```
dir /b /a-d
```
這個命令會列出當前目錄下的所有文件(不包括子目錄),`/b`表示簡潔格式,`/a-d`表示不包括目錄。

2. **Linux/Unix命令行**:
在終端中,使用`cd`命令切換到目標文件夾,然後輸入以下命令:
```
ls -p | grep -v /
```
這個命令會列出當前目錄下的所有文件和文件夾,`-p`會在每個文件名後添加一個斜杠,`grep -v /`會過濾掉文件夾。

3. **PowerShell**(Windows):
打開PowerShell,使用`cd`命令切換到目標文件夾,然後輸入以下命令:
```
Get-ChildItem -File | Select-Object Name
```
這個命令會獲取當前目錄下的所有文件,並只選擇文件名。

4. **python腳本**:
如果你熟悉Python,可以編寫一個簡單的腳本來列出文件夾中的所有文件:
```python
import os

directory = '/path/to/your/directory'
for filename in os.listdir(directory):
if os.path.isfile(os.path.join(directory, filename)):
print(filename)
```
將`/path/to/your/directory`替換為你的目標文件夾路徑,然後運行腳本。

以上方法可以幫助你列印出文件夾下所有的文件名。請根據你的操作系統和偏好選擇合適的方法。

熱點內容
androidapp源碼下載 發布:2025-06-26 10:59:18 瀏覽:554
linux安裝nagios 發布:2025-06-26 10:59:17 瀏覽:38
408發動機壓縮比 發布:2025-06-26 10:54:18 瀏覽:539
psv上傳失敗 發布:2025-06-26 10:52:45 瀏覽:145
linux改變文件所有者的命令 發布:2025-06-26 10:46:53 瀏覽:987
杜阮哪裡有安卓系統手機 發布:2025-06-26 10:16:43 瀏覽:11
php合並excel單元格 發布:2025-06-26 10:06:18 瀏覽:71
禁止第五人格伺服器ip 發布:2025-06-26 09:56:26 瀏覽:342
管理系統資料庫的實現 發布:2025-06-26 09:43:15 瀏覽:246
伺服器修改為14位ip 發布:2025-06-26 09:37:04 瀏覽:86